What is 3PL Logistics Fulfillment and Why is it Important for Your Business?

Third-party logistics (3PL) is a service that allows businesses to outsource their logistics operations to a specialized provider. The provider takes care of warehousing, inventory management, order processing, and shipping. 3PL logistics fulfillment is important for businesses because it allows them to focus on their core competencies while leaving the logistics functions to the experts. With the right 3PL provider, businesses can optimize their supply chain, reduce costs, and improve customer satisfaction.

Moreover, 3PL providers have the expertise and resources to handle complex logistics challenges, such as international shipping, customs clearance, and regulatory compliance. They also have access to advanced technology and software that can streamline logistics processes and provide real-time visibility into inventory levels and shipment status. By partnering with a 3PL provider, businesses can benefit from these capabilities without having to invest in expensive infrastructure and personnel.

A Step-by-Step Guide on How Shipping Pilot’s 3PL Logistics Fulfillment Works

Here’s a step-by-step guide on how Shipping Pilot’s 3PL logistics fulfillment works:

  1. The customer sends their products to Shipping Pilot’s warehouse
  2. Shipping Pilot receives the products, scans them into their system, and stores them in the warehouse
  3. The customer sends orders to Shipping Pilot’s system via API, CSV, or manual data entry
  4. Shipping Pilot picks and packs the products and prepares them for shipping
  5. Shipping Pilot ships the orders to the customer’s customers using their network of carriers
  6. Shipping Pilot provides shipping updates and tracking information to the customer and their customers

The Key Differences Between In-house Fulfillment and Outsourced 3PL Services

There are several key differences between in-house fulfillment and outsourced 3PL services. In-house fulfillment requires a warehouse, personnel, equipment, and the expertise to manage logistics operations. Outsourced 3PL services, on the other hand, allow businesses to outsource their logistics operations to a specialized provider who has the infrastructure and expertise to handle all aspects of the supply chain. Outsourced 3PL services can be more cost-effective, more scalable, and more efficient than in-house fulfillment.

Common Challenges in Implementing a 3PL Logistics Fulfillment Solution and How to Overcome Them

Implementing a 3PL logistics fulfillment solution can be challenging, but with the right approach, businesses can overcome these challenges. One of the main challenges is integrating the 3PL provider’s systems with the customer’s systems. This can be overcome by using APIs or other integration tools. Another challenge is ensuring that the 3PL provider has the capacity to handle rapidly changing demand levels. This can be addressed by selecting a provider with a scalable infrastructure and sound logistics management practices.

How to Measure the Success of Your 3PL Logistics Fulfillment Strategy

Measuring the success of your 3PL logistics fulfillment strategy is key to optimizing your logistics operations. Some metrics that you can use to gauge success include order accuracy, shipping speed, on-time delivery, and customer satisfaction. You can also track cost metrics such as freight cost per order or inventory holding cost. By tracking these metrics, you can identify areas for improvement and make changes to your logistics strategy accordingly.
